웹 페이지에 벡터 그래픽을 추가하는 방법

게시 됨: 2023-02-08

웹 페이지용 벡터 그래픽을 만들 때 고려해야 할 몇 가지 사항이 있습니다. 하나는 사용할 파일 형식이고 다른 하나는 svg를 img src css 로 선택하는 방법입니다. svg, eps 및 ai의 세 가지 일반적인 벡터 그래픽 형식이 있습니다. 웹 페이지에 사용하기에 가장 좋은 형식은 svg입니다. 모든 웹 브라우저에서 지원하는 표준 형식이며 파일 크기도 매우 작습니다. 파일 형식을 결정했으면 다음 단계는 svg를 img src css로 선택하는 것입니다. 이는 두 가지 방법으로 수행할 수 있습니다. 첫 번째는 HTML 태그를 사용하는 것이고 두 번째는 CSS 속성을 사용하는 것입니다. HTML 태그는 svg를 img src css로 선택하는 가장 간단한 방법입니다. 웹 페이지에 다음 코드를 추가하기만 하면 됩니다. "name-of-your-svg-file.svg"를 svg 파일 이름으로 바꿉니다. 그게 전부입니다. CSS 속성은 조금 더 복잡하지만 여전히 비교적 사용하기 쉽습니다. 웹 페이지에 추가해야 하는 CSS 코드는 다음과 같습니다. .element { background-image: url("name-of-your-svg-file.svg"); } 다시 한 번 "name-of-your-svg-file.svg"를 svg 파일 이름으로 바꿉니다. img src css로 svg를 선택하는 것이 전부입니다. HTML 태그 또는 CSS 속성을 사용하여 웹 페이지에 벡터 그래픽을 쉽게 추가할 수 있습니다.

CSS에서는 데이터 URI와 함께 SVG를 사용할 수 있지만 Webkit 기반 브라우저에서는 인코딩을 사용해야 합니다. encodeURIComponent()를 사용하는 encodingVNG는 어디에 두든 작동합니다. XMLns에는 xmlns=' http:// //www.w3.org/2000/svg' 구문이 포함되어야 합니다. 존재하지 않으면 마술처럼 추가됩니다.

Svg를 Img Src로 사용할 수 있습니까?

Svg를 Img Src로 사용할 수 있습니까?
사진 제공 – https://deliciousbrains.com

예, svg 파일을 img 태그의 src로 사용할 수 있습니다. 품질 손실 없이 이미지 크기를 조정하거나 이미지 색상을 변경하려는 경우에 유용할 수 있습니다.

이미지를 보다 다양한 형식으로 변환하려면 SVG를 사용할 수 있습니다. 또한 다양한 이전 브라우저 및 장치에서 애니메이션 및 투명도를 지원합니다. 데스크톱이나 모바일 장치에 JPG 또는 PNG 이미지가 있는 경우 SVG 파일로 변환하면 이미지 품질이 크게 향상됩니다.

CSS 콘텐츠에서 Svg를 사용할 수 있습니까?

CSS에서는 데이터 URI를 사용하여 SVG를 사용할 수 있지만 인코딩하지 않으면 Webkit 기반 브라우저에서만 작동합니다. 웹에서 encodeURIComponent()로 SVG를 인코딩하면 모든 곳에서 작동합니다. SVG에는 XMLns=' http: //www.w3.org/2000/svg'를 사용해야 하므로 xmlns가 필요합니다.

SVG 이미지: 반응형으로 만드는 방법

*image> 요소로 그린 낙서는 일반적으로 반응하지 않는 반면, *svg로 만든 낙서는 *use* 요소를 사용하여 비동기적으로 로드할 수 있습니다. 결과적으로 SVG는 모든 자식에 대한 컴포지터로 간주되므로 반응형 업데이트를 받을 수 있습니다.

Svgs에 이미지가 포함될 수 있습니까?

요소 이미지> SVG는 .VG 파일 확장자의 일부로 이미지를 포함합니다. 래스터 이미지 또는 다른 유형의 벡터 그래픽이 있는 이미지를 표시하는 데 사용할 수 있습니다. SVG 소프트웨어가 작동하려면 JPEG, PNG 및 기타 .VG 파일을 비롯한 다양한 이미지 형식을 지원해야 합니다.

SVG 이미지: 저작권 및 포함 방법

ofsvg 이미지 사용은 저작권으로 보호됩니까? svg 이미지 는 인터넷에서 저작권이 있으며 작성자가 소유권을 보유합니다. 어떤 식으로든 사용하려면 svg 파일을 보호해야 합니다. 인터넷에서 ansvg 파일을 다운로드하여 웹 사이트에서 사용하려면 작성자의 허가가 필요합니다. 이미지를 svg에 추가하는 가장 좋은 방법은 무엇입니까? *image 요소를 사용하여 svg 파일에 이미지를 삽입할 수 있습니다. 이미지 요소에는 이미지의 속성을 지정하는 데 사용할 수 있는 여러 속성이 있습니다. 사진의 너비와 높이는 픽셀을 사용하여 설정할 수 있는 가장 일반적인 두 가지 특성입니다. svg circle은 [image] 요소가 있는 이미지 요소를 포함하지 않는 한 이미지를 포함해서는 안 됩니다. 클리핑 경로를 설정하려면 이미지의 클리핑 경로 설정에서 *clipPath* 요소를 사용하세요. 클립 경로 요소는 이미지의 클립 경로를 정의합니다. 클리핑 경로는 이미지가 나타날 svg 원 내의 영역을 정의합니다.

언제 Svg를 사용하면 안 됩니까?

SVG는 벡터 기반 프로그램이기 때문에 사진뿐만 아니라 미세한 디테일과 질감을 수행할 수 없습니다. 더 적은 색상과 모양을 사용하는 로고, 아이콘 및 기타 평면 그래픽을 만드는 데 가장 적합합니다. 또한 대부분의 최신 브라우저는 SVG를 지원하지만 구형 브라우저는 제대로 작동하지 않을 수 있습니다.

Jpeg보다 Svg를 사용해야 하는 이유

JPEG는 이미지 크기가 더 작은 반면 sva는 더 선명합니다. 간단한 그래픽만 사용해야 하는 경우 sva를 사용해야 합니다.


Svg를 배경 이미지 CSS로 사용할 수 있습니까?

Svg를 배경 이미지 CSS로 사용할 수 있습니까?
사진 제공 – https://imgur.com

CSS에서 a.sva 파일의 이미지는 PNG, JPG 또는 GIF 파일과 마찬가지로 배경 이미지로 사용할 수도 있습니다. 유연성과 선명도를 포함하여 SVG가 가진 것과 동일한 놀라운 기능이 이 형식에 있습니다. 옵션 외에도 래스터 그래픽이 수행하는 모든 것을 반복할 수 있는 옵션이 있습니다.

이 협력은 웹 디자인을 보다 사용자 친화적으로 만들기 위해 두 기술이 기울이는 노력을 나타냅니다. SVG를 디자인의 기초로 사용하면 일반적으로 복잡한 CSS를 배워야 하는 시각적으로 더 매력적이고 복잡한 디자인을 만들 수 있습니다. 보다 구체적으로 말하면 CSS를 사용하여 요소의 스타일을 지정할 수 있으므로 모든 브라우저에서 액세스할 수 있는 간단한 디자인이 생성됩니다.

CSS로 Svg 재정의

특정 요구 사항에 맞게 크기를 조정할 수 있는 SVG(Scalable Vector Graphics) 형식이 있습니다. CSS는 SVG에서 높이 또는 너비로 지정하는 svg>의 높이 및 너비 속성을 재정의합니다. 결과적으로 svg%22width%20000;%22 height%22auto%22와 같은 규칙은 코드에서 설정한 크기와 종횡비를 취소하고 인라인 SVG의 기본 높이를 받게 됩니다.

Svg를 이미지로 어떻게 사용합니까?

Svg를 이미지로 어떻게 사용합니까?
사진 제공 – https://pinimg.com

SVG(Scalable Vector Graphics)는 벡터 기반 그래픽을 웹에 표시할 수 있는 파일 형식입니다. 래스터 기반인 JPEG 또는 PNG와 같은 기존 이미지 형식과 달리 SVG 파일은 품질 손실 없이 크기를 늘리거나 줄일 수 있는 수학 방정식을 사용하여 생성됩니다. 따라서 모든 장치에서 멋지게 보이는 반응형 디자인을 만드는 데 사용할 수 있는 웹 사이트에서 사용하기에 이상적입니다. 웹사이트에서 SVG 파일을 이미지로 사용하려면 HTML 태그를 사용해야 합니다. 태그는 HTML 문서에 이미지를 삽입하는 데 사용됩니다. SVG 파일을 사용하려면 태그의 src 속성을 SVG 파일의 URL로 설정해야 합니다. height 및 width 속성을 사용하여 이미지 크기를 설정할 수도 있습니다. 이미지 크기를 조정하려면 태그를 사용해야 합니다. 이 태그는 Scalable Vector Graphics를 HTML 문서에 삽입하는 데 사용됩니다. SVG 파일을 사용하려면 태그의 src 속성을 SVG 파일의 URL로 설정해야 합니다. 벡터 그래픽 편집기를 사용하면 해상도 손실 없이 크기를 조정하거나 축소할 수 있는 고품질 그래픽을 디자인할 수 있습니다. 결과적으로 웹 사이트, 인포그래픽 등을 포함하여 그래픽이 많은 다양한 프로젝트에서 사용할 수 있습니다. SVG는 웹 친화적인 특성에도 불구하고 다른 유형의 그래픽 파일에 비해 몇 가지 장점이 있습니다. Adobe Illustrator 또는 Inkscape와 같은 벡터 편집기에서 파일을 편집할 수 있으므로 그래픽을 만든 후 그래픽을 변경하는 데 사용할 수 있습니다. 웹사이트나 다른 프로젝트를 위한 그래픽을 만드는 방법을 찾고 있다면 SVG는 훌륭한 옵션입니다.Svg 이미지를 사용해야 하는 이유SVG 이미지를 이미지 형식으로 사용하는 방법은 다양합니다. 브라우저는 HTML img> 또는 HTML svg>와 같은 HTML 요소와 CSS와 같은 CSS 요소를 지원합니다. 특정 상황에서 SVG 이미지를 사용하여 다른 이미지를 간단한 아이콘으로 바꿀 수 있습니다. 그래프, 차트, 회사 로고 등 복잡한 일러스트레이션과 함께 사용할 수 있습니다. CloudConvert는 SVG 파일을 JPEG로 변환할 수 있는 온라인 도구입니다. SVG, PDF 및 EPS 외에도 많은 다른 프로그램에서 지원됩니다. 옵션을 사용하여 해상도, 품질 및 파일 크기를 설정할 수 있습니다.Img Src Svg Change Color Cssimg Src svg change color css 속성은 태그를 사용하여 HTML 문서에 삽입된 이미지의 색상을 변경하는 데 사용됩니다. 이 속성의 값은 16진수 및 RGB 값을 포함하여 유효한 CSS 색상 값이 될 수 있습니다.Css에서 Svg 이미지 색상을 변경할 수 있습니까?SVG 파일을 편집한 후 svg 태그를 fill=”currentColor”로 채운 다음 삭제합니다. 발견한 다른 모든 채우기 속성. currentColor에서 고정 색상 대신 키워드(사용 중인 고정 색상이 아닌)가 사용됩니다. 그런 다음 CSS를 사용하여 요소의 색상 속성을 설정하거나 상위 목록에 포함하여 색상을 변경할 수 있습니다.Svg: 장점 및 단점색상 및 세부 사항은 SVG로 달성하기 쉽지 않습니다. 그러나 래스터 이미지를 벡터 이미지로 변환하는 데 사용할 수 있는 온라인 응용 프로그램이 있습니다. 색상 및 세부 정보와 관련하여 이 기능을 보다 효과적으로 사용할 수 있습니다.Css에서 Svg 색상을 변경하는 데 사용되는 속성은 무엇입니까? 채우기 속성으로 SVG 모양의 색상을 설정합니다.CssSvg에서 CSS는 확장 가능한 벡터 그래픽의 스타일을 지정하는 데 사용할 수 있습니다. , HTML 스타일을 지정하는 데 사용할 수 있는 것과 같습니다. 이것은 인라인으로 수행하거나 별도의 스타일시트에서 CSS 규칙을 사용하여 수행할 수 있습니다. 벡터 그래픽은 매우 복잡할 수 있으므로 더 작은 조각으로 나누는 것이 종종 도움이 됩니다. CSS를 사용하면 각 부분의 스타일을 개별적으로 지정할 수 있으므로 벡터 그래픽 작업이 훨씬 쉬워집니다.브라우저에서 SVG를 보려면 먼저 연결된 파일의 콘텐츠 유형을 "application/x-svg"로 설정해야 합니다. XML” 또는 “application/x-shockwave-svg.” 결과적으로 브라우저는 파일 내용을 sva 파일로 표시하기 시작합니다. 이러한 플러그인을 지원하는 브라우저가 있는 경우 SVG 전체를 볼 수 있습니다. 단순히 HTML 문서 내에 SVG 조각을 포함하려는 경우 콘텐츠 유형을 지정할 필요가 없습니다. svg 요소와 SVG 조각을 삽입하면 브라우저가 자동으로 두 요소의 HTML 렌더링을 생성합니다. img src=”image.svg”>와 같은 SVG를 사용하거나 CSS background-image로 사용하고 파일이 올바르게 연결되고 모든 것이 올바르게 보이지만 브라우저에 표시되지 않는 경우 서버 때문일 수 있습니다. 잘못된 URL로 제공하고 있습니다.Img Src Svg가 작동하지 않음"img src svg"가 작동하지 않을 수 있는 몇 가지 이유가 있습니다. 먼저 svg에 올바른 파일 확장명(.svg, .svgz, .svgxml)을 사용하고 있는지 확인하세요. 이것이 문제가 아니라면 서버가 svg 파일을 제공하도록 구성되지 않았을 가능성이 있습니다. Html에서 Svg를 사용하는 방법 *svg 태그를 사용하면 SVG 이미지를 HTML 문서에 직접 쓸 수 있습니다. 다음 단계를 수행할 수 있습니다. VS 코드 또는 선호하는 IDE에서 SVG 이미지를 열고 코드를 복사한 다음 HTML 문서의 body> 요소에 붙여넣습니다. 아래 데모에서 볼 수 있듯이 모든 단계를 주의 깊게 따르는 것이 중요합니다. SVG를 HTML에 삽입할 수 있습니다. 귀하의 웹 사이트가 가능한 한 사용자 친화적인지 확인하려면 개선을 위해 지속적으로 노력해야 합니다. 이를 위해 HTML 포함을 사용하여 HTML 페이지에 SVG를 추가할 수 있습니다. 2D 그래픽 언어 SVG는 2D 그래픽을 설명하는 반면 캔버스 라이브러리는 JavaScript를 사용하여 필요에 따라 2D 그래픽을 그립니다. SVG DOM을 사용하여 요소에 액세스할 수 있습니다. SVG 요소를 이벤트 핸들러에 첨부할 수 있으므로 해당 동작을 쉽게 제어할 수 있습니다. 또한 SVG DOM은 XML 기반이므로 그 안에서 모든 요소를 ​​사용할 수 있습니다. 결과적으로 페이지에 SVG를 추가할 때 다른 브라우저와의 호환성에 대해 걱정할 필요가 없습니다. sva를 사용한 HTML 임베딩은 페이지를 표시하고 성능을 향상시키는 좋은 방법입니다.Img Svgimg svg는 벡터 그래픽을 만드는 데 사용할 수 있는 이미지 파일입니다. 일러스트레이션, 로고 및 기타 그래픽을 만드는 데 사용할 수 있습니다.Svg 이미지 온라인 색상 변경SVG 요소 색상을 변경하는 방법은 무엇입니까? SVG를 업로드하면 색상 편집기의 왼쪽 열에 다양한 색상 옵션이 표시됩니다. 모든 경우에 변경하려는 요소 중 하나만 선택하면 됩니다. 색상을 바꾸려면 하나를 선택합니다.오버레이 Svg Css오버레이는 이미지 위에 배치되는 반투명 레이어입니다. 오버레이용 CSS는 웹사이트의 "style.css" 파일에서 찾을 수 있습니다. 오버레이 코드는 일반적으로 "div" 태그에 배치됩니다. "div" 태그는 문서 내에서 구분을 만드는 데 사용됩니다. "class" 속성은 요소를 오버레이로 식별하는 데 사용됩니다. "불투명도" 속성은 오버레이의 투명도를 설정하는 데 사용됩니다.Svg 오버레이란 무엇입니까?CSS 절대 위치 지정을 사용하여 HTML 문서에서 하나가 다른 하나를 오버레이하도록 두 개의 외부 SVG 이미지를 배치할 수 있습니다. 또한 HTML 요소 아래 또는 위에 배치할 수도 있습니다. HTML 형식의 텍스트.저널리즘에서 오버레이 사용오버레이 사용은 이미지에서 잘못된 정보를 억제하는 것입니다. 저널리스트는 사실 정보가 기사에 표시될 때 오버레이 인용을 사용합니다. 오버레이는 언론인이 잘못된 정보의 시각적 증거를 제시하기 위해 자주 사용합니다. 정치인은 가짜 이미지가 어떻게 유권자를 속이는 데 사용되는지 보여주기 위해 오버레이를 사용할 수 있습니다. 오버레이는 다른 컨텍스트의 컴퓨팅에도 사용됩니다. 예를 들어 오버레이는 이미 저장된 것을 저장하는 것과는 반대로 프로그램 코드 블록 또는 기타 데이터를 메인 메모리로 전송하는 데 사용할 수 있습니다. 이 프로그래밍 방법을 사용하면 프로그램이 컴퓨터의 주 메모리보다 커질 수 있습니다.Css에서 이미지를 어떻게 오버레이합니까?CSS 오버레이 효과를 얻으려면 각각 background-image 및 background-CSS 속성과 같은 속성이 있어야 합니다. 절대, 위, 아래, 오른쪽, 왼쪽 속성 중 하나를 선택하여 오버레이 이미지 또는 텍스트의 위치를 ​​변경할 수 있습니다. Css로 이미지 배치 및 크기를 제어하는 ​​방법 background-position 및 background-size 속성, 다른 한편 손으로 이미지의 배치와 크기를 제어하는 ​​데 사용할 수 있습니다.